Why the flux in the outlet is small?

0

The common solar water heater is non-pressurized that two reasons can cause the small flux. One is the solar water heater is not assembled at a high position. The vertical gap between the heater and nozzle is not large enough (especial on the top ground).The way to solve this problem is to increase the height of the heater or enlarge the diameter of the pipes. Another problem is the pipes are bending. The way to solve this problem is to re-settle the pipes. The third problem is that the something blocks the outlet, inlet or the pipes.
